- [ ] **Step 7: Breaker override escrow.** After sealing the signing keys for the Tallgrove upstream API circuit breaker, confirm the support team can force the breaker open during a full outage. The override bundle lives in the sealed escrow drawer and is useless without its unlock phrase. Two ceremony witnesses must initial this step before proceeding. The escrow bundle is decrypted with the recovery passphrase that follows.

vault phrase of kahip-kahop = holath-quenmir

// Broker upgrade notes for plugin authors:
// Quillbus 4.x replaces the legacy 3.x wire protocol. Plugins must
// construct the client with explicit protocol negotiation enabled,
// or connections to the Larkfield cluster will be silently downgraded
// and dropped after 30s. Topic names are unchanged. For local testing
// against the sandbox broker, authenticate with the key below.

API key for bafof-bagaf: qvz2-qi

Subject: Handover — Fixturewright release duties

Hi all,

As I rotate off, release duties for Fixturewright (our test-data factory library) pass to the new folks. Cut releases every other Thursday, run the seed-consistency suite first, and tag from main only. Docs live in the internal wiki under Tooling. Publishing to the Brindlevale package mirror requires the signing key below, so store it carefully.

deploy key for kajof-fajop: bky6_gDHw9Q

Vendor note for the release manager: Corvane Digital supplies the Lanternkit shared component library under a quarterly support agreement. Note that Lanternkit follows strict semantic versioning, but Corvane reserves patch releases for security fixes only; visual changes may land in minors, so pin exact versions in release branches. Any version bump shipped to production must be recorded in the vendor register. Questions about upcoming releases go to the address below.

escalation mailbox, yajeg-bageg: quenax.olidor@lumiccorp.internal